Pexip Infinity RTMP Access Control Bypass v38.x (fixed v39.0)
CVE-2025-66378 Published on December 25, 2025
Pexip Infinity 38.0 and 38.1 before 39.0 has insufficient access control in the RTMP implementation, allowing an attacker to disconnect RTMP streams traversing a Proxy Node.

What is an AuthZ Vulnerability?
The software performs an authorization check when an actor attempts to access a resource or perform an action, but it does not correctly perform the check. This allows attackers to bypass intended access restrictions.
CVE-2025-66378 has been classified to as an AuthZ vulnerability or weakness.

Affected Versions
Pexip Infinity:- Version 38.0 and below 39.0 is affected.
